> Just for a point of discussion,  setting these two password fields to
> random numbers doesn’t seem to provide any benefit to the administrator.
> I’m assuming these are required to be there rather than a blank space.   It
> would be very beneficial to the administrator if something useable was put
> into that field, even if they were all the same.  For example – maybe a
> specific number such as 5 + extension number.   Or set them all to 1234 or
> something similar.  This way, the end user can be instructed on what is
> there, and how to change it, rather than the administrator having to change
> all of them to something useable.****
> ** **
> With a random number, the end user can’t log into voicemail or the GUI to
> change it until after the administrator makes a change since it is random
> and hidden.
>
>
> Is there a "require password change on next login" option for the web
> portal and voicemail?  If a default passwords is populated, it should
> select this option by default as well.
